Truly Voxarian World
Truly Voxarian World is a Minecraft Fabric mod designed for the Voxarian World modpack. It introduces factors and mechanics to minecraft 1.20.1 that make the world feel like a simulation and not just a backdrop.
🛠 Current Features
- Soil Health System: Farmland has health that degrades when crops are harvested, encouraging careful management.
- Harvest Costs: Mature crops consume more soil vitality than immature ones.
- Monoculture Penalty: Planting the same crop too densely nearby incurs an additional penalty.
- Crop Rotation Bonus: Switching crop types on the same plot grants a health bonus.
- Daily Regeneration: Bare farmland recovers health each in-game day, accelerated by nearby companion flowers.
- Soil Checker Tool: Inspect soil health, check for companion flowers, and see current crop status.
